Born in Riga, Latvia, Aleksejs “Alex” Halavins rose from maritime roots to become a central figure in significant-stakes world transport. A graduate on the Latvian Maritime Academy, he commenced his vocation on deep-sea tankers, rapidly distinguishing himself by means of complex mastery and leadership. He attained his captain’s rank and later shifted emphasis to fleet operations, logistics, and security management. His trajectory displays not simply depth of information but adaptability and strategic mentality.

Halavins’s vocation is marked by rising affect across Europe, the Middle East, and Asia. He cultivated a reputation for customizing operational methods to align with regional regulations and business enterprise customs—a skill that earned belief from both of those international associates and local stakeholders. These days, he heads multiple delivery and trading corporations which is regarded for his ability to take care of worldwide crews and sophisticated logistical networks with precision and cultural insight.

Nonetheless, Halavins’s profile took on new Proportions when Western investigative shops reported his involvement in Russia’s “shadow fleet” oil trade. As alleged, he and his Dubai-registered corporations facilitated the purchase and transport of Russian crude at charges above Western price tag cap restrictions. In between 2023 and mid‑2024, his firms reportedly acquired virtually sixty million barrels of oil at around $82–$84 per barrel—properly higher than the sanctioned optimum of $60—channeling roughly $1.four billion additional to Russian producers than permitted

More investigations unveiled Halavins’s ties to tanker organizations operating vessels among Russian and Asian ports—specially in India and China—underneath seemingly authentic company umbrellas in Cyprus and Dubai. These vessels, at times registered to nominee owners, were traced by using maritime databases and customs paperwork. Critics argue this Procedure exemplifies the loopholes through which Russia bypassed Western embargoes .

When confronted by reporters, Halavins denied any wrongdoing. He affirmed that he operates fully within just Worldwide regulation and beneath sanction restrictions, calling the allegations provocations missing compound . Nonetheless, Western authorities, such as the U.S. Treasury’s Business office of Overseas Assets Command, have placed him on sanctions lists—citing his purpose in facilitating Russia’s continued petro-dollar income.

This chapter marked a turning issue in his occupation. Authorities in Latvia reportedly scrutinized the revelations, and regional push commenced monitoring his things to do intently . Internationally, Halavins turned emblematic of how sanctioned regimes circumvent export controls—combining company structures, maritime assets, and worldwide trade networks to problem enforcement.
